Marcus Aurelius. As Caesar, AD 139-161. Æ Sestertius (32mm, 27.59 g, 11h). Rome mint. Struck AD 159-160. Bare-headed, draped, and cuirassed bust right / Mars advancing right, holding spear and trophy over shoulder. RIC III 1352Ab (Pius); Banti 385. VF, attractive dark brown patina with touches of red. Rare. Banti records only three examples.


Ex Classical Numismatic Group 84 (5 May 2010), lot 1048.
